◆PP Isihlungi sikakotini

Isici sokuhlunga ukotini se-PP senziwa ngokuyinhloko nge-polypropylene, okungajwayelekile kubantu abaningi, kodwa ukotini we-PP (hhayi isici sokuhlunga ukotini we-PP) usebenzisa i-polypropylene njengento eluhlaza isetshenziswa kabanzi ekuphileni kwansuku zonke. Ukugcwaliswa okuvamile kwemicamelo esiyisebenzisayo i-PP ikotini eyenziwe nge-polypropylene. Lapho siya ku-AliExpress ukuze sikhethe amathoyizi aluhlaza, izigcwalisi eziningi ezikhonjiswe emininingwaneni yomkhiqizo zazihlanganisa ukotini kadoli nokotini ongenalutho. Eqinisweni, bonke babhekisela kukotini we-PP owenziwe nge-polypropylene. Uma ucabanga ngale ndlela, ingabe ujwayelene ne-polypropylene? O, ngikhohliwe ukusho ukuthi i-polypropylene ngokwayo ayinabo ubuthi, ngakho-ke ingasetshenziswa njengento eluhlaza yezakhi zokuhlunga. Nakuba kokubili isici sokuhlunga ukotini se-PP kanye ne-PP ukotini njengezinto zokugcwalisa zenziwe nge-polypropylene, kusenomehluko omkhulu phakathi kwalokhu kokubili. Isici sesihlungi sikakotini se-PP sibhekisela ekuncibilikeni kwe-polypropylene okuyisihlungi esiphephethwayo. Mayelana nesici sesihlungi esincibilikisiwe, isitatimende sokuqala sithi: isici sesihlungi esincibilikayo senziwa ngezinhlayiya ze-polypropylene ezingenabuthi nezingenaphunga, ezincibilikiswa ngokushisisa, ukuphotha, ukudweba, nokwakheka. Isici sesihlungi se-tubular esakhiwe. Ukunemba kokuhlunga kwesici sesihlungi sikakotini se-PP sisukela ku-0.5μm (micron) kuya ku-20μm. Ububanzi bezinwele zomuntu busukela ku-0.017 kuye ku-0.18 mm (ama-microns ayi-17 kuye kwayi-18, idatha ivela ku-Wikipedia).

Izakhi zokuhlunga ukotini ze-PP ezisetshenziswa ezihlanzini zamanzi zifaka izakhi zokuhlunga ukotini ezijwayelekile ze-PP kanye nezici zokuhlunga ukotini ze-PP ezinembayo, ezivame ukufakwa engxenyeni yokuqala neyesithathu yezakhi zokuhlunga ngokulandelanayo. I-polypropylene encibilikayo ekhonjiswa abanye abathengisi ekhasini lephromoshini izwakala njengomkhiqizo osezingeni eliphezulu, kodwa empeleni iyisici sokuhlunga ukotini se-PP.

Ngokuqonda kwami, umehluko phakathi kwesici sokuhlunga ukotini esinembe kakhulu se-PP kanye nento evamile yesihlungi sikakotini se-PP ikakhulukazi ilele kusayizi wembotshana. Usayizi wezimbotshana zikakotini we-PP onembe kakhulu mncane kunokakotini we-PP ojwayelekile, ongahluza ukungcola okuncane. Lapho amanzi ethu okuphuza egeleza ungqimba lokuqala lukakotini we-PP, kufana nokugeleza esikrinini, esivame ukuvalela izinhlayiya ezinkulu zenhlabathi nokunye ukungcola okubonakalayo. Uma amanzi egeleza kungqimba lwesithathu lukakotini we-PP onemba kakhulu, azohlunga izinto ezicolekile kunesendlalelo sokuqala. ◆I-Granular Activated Carbon

Ngikholwa ukuthi wonke umuntu akayena umuntu ongaziwa kukhabhoni ecushiwe. Ikhabhoni ecushiwe inezinto eziqinile zokukhanga.
Ikhabhoni ecushiwe isetshenziswa kabanzi ngenxa yezimpawu zayo. Abantu abaningi baye bavula izikhwama zekhabhoni ezimotweni zabo ukuze basuse iphunga, futhi abanye abantu ezindlini ezisanda kulungiswa bazofaka izikhwama zekhabhoni ezicushiwe ukuze bakhiphe i-formaldehyde.

Sivame ukubona ukuthi izihlanzi eziningi zamanzi zisebenzisa ikhabhoni ecushiwe njengesihlungi epheshaneni lesihlanzi samanzi, okuhlanganisa i-granular activated carbon, i-carbon fiber filter element, i-carbon rod filter element, njll. Ngakho-ke zihluke kanjani?
Igobolondo likakhukhunathi elicushwe isihlungi sekhabhoni elivame ukusetshenziswa ezihlanzini zamanzi liwuhlobo lwekhabhoni ecushiwe (UDF/GAC) ecushiwe. Ngaphezu kwalokho, impahla eluhlaza eyinhloko ye-granular activated carbon ingaba amagobolondo amabhilikosi, amagobolondo e-walnut, namanye amagobolondo ezithelo noma amalahle anjenge-anthracite. Ikhabhoni ecushiwe eyakhiwe ngokuvula lezi njengezinto zokusetshenziswa yenze izimbotshana eziningi ezincane, kodwa usayizi wokusabalalisa lezi zimbotshana awufani. Ngokusho kobubanzi, ahlukaniswe ama-micropores angaphansi kwe-2nm, ama-macropores angaphezu kuka-50nm, nama-mesopores phakathi (Obizwa nangokuthi i-transition hole). Ezinye izimbotshana zingafinyelela ku-1000nm.

Isihlungi se-Carbon Rod (CTO)
Izinto ezivame ukusetshenziswa kakhulu zokuhlunga i-carbon rod yikhabhoni ecushiwe ne-sintered activated carbon (ikhabhoni ekhishiwe ecushiwe nayo ifakiwe ku-CTO, kodwa ngenxa yokuthi umthamo we-adsorption mancane kakhulu ngesikhathi sokubumba). Ikhabhoni ecushiwe ecindezelwe yakhiwa ngokuxuba impushana yekhabhoni ecushiwe kanye ne-inorganic liquid binder ngaphansi kwengcindezi ephezulu.
I-Sintered activated carbon sintered ezingeni lokushisa eliphezulu ngemva kokuxuba i-carbon powder eyenziwe yasebenza kanye ne-polymer hot-melt pore-forming material. Ngenxa yokuthi i-polymer hot-melt pore-forming material esetshenziswa kukhabhoni ecushiwe ene-sintered nayo yakha izimbotshana emazingeni okushisa aphezulu, futhi i-inorganic liquid binder kukhabhoni ecushiwe ayikwazi ukwakha izimbotshana ngaphansi kwengcindezi ephezulu, i-sintered activated carbon inemiphumela engcono yokuhlunga kanye ne-decolorization kunekhabhoni ecushiwe ecindezelwe kangcono. ◆Isihlungi Se-Carbon Fiber
I-elementi yesihlungi se-carbon fibre ibhekisela ku-activated carbon fiber filter element (ACF). I-activated carbon fibre ayiselona uhlobo oluvamile lwempuphu noma oluyimbudumbudu lwekhabhoni ecushiwe, kodwa i-fibrous. I-fiber iyi-filament eqhubekayo noma engapheli. I-activated carbon fibre yakhiwa Into eyakhiwe ngosilika ocushiwe onekhabhoni. Le micu imbozwe ngenani elikhulu lama-micropores nama-mesopores. Ngokungafani ne-carbon activated granular, ayinawo ama-macropores futhi ayifani. Lapho amanzi egeleza emicu yekhabhoni ecushiwe, izimbotshana ezisemicu emihle kulula ukuthintana nezinto ezisemanzini kunezimbotshana ezingaphakathi kwekhabhoni ecushiwe enevolumu efanayo, futhi isivinini sokukhangisa siyashesha impela kunaleso sekhabhoni ecushiwe eyimbudumbudu. Njengoba indawo engaphezulu ethintana namanzi inkulu kunekhabhoni ecushiwe ecushiwe, futhi lapho amanzi egeleza, izimbotshana eziningi zangaphakathi zekhabhoni ecushiwe azihlangani nokungcola emanzini, ngakho-ke ngaphansi kwezimo ezifanayo, umthamo ofanayo we-carbon fiber ocushiwe ungamunca izinto (njengokuthi Ingakwazi ukuqongelela izifo ze-carcinogenic trichlorethylethylethylethyle ne-canschericolitis) noma izifo zesitho emzimbeni womuntu ngaphansi kwezimo ezithile). Yiqiniso, i-carbon fiber nayo inokushiyeka: izindleko ziphezulu, futhi akukho datha etholiwe ebonisa ukuthi i-carbon fiber evuliwe inamandla okukhipha umbala.

Ekusebenzeni kokunqamula izinhlayiya ezinkulu, i-activated carbon fiber filter element>activated carbon rod>granular activated carbon
